今天来看一下 Quarkus 构建出来本机可执行文件到底比 Spring 应用能快多少, 生态成熟度不在这里讨论 。 TLDR先上结论, 与只有一个 Controller Spring Web 应用做下对比。应用启动时间:0.012s vs 2.294s镜像大小:49MB vs 237 MBSpring 应用镜像使用 openjdk:11.
1、C++和C都是属于编译型语言,本来.c文件都是用高级语言编写,计算机是不能识别高级语言,所以,必须要通过编译,链接等手段,将.c文件转换成可执行文件,可执行文件就是纯二进制文件,然后计算机才能够执行。上述命令过程,是外壳(shell)调用操作系统一个叫加载器函数,它拷贝可执行文件p中代码和数据到存储器,然后将控制转移到这个程序开头。2、 1. Python是一门解释型语
# Docker CMD 执行文件执行:如何实现 作为一名经验丰富开发者,我很高兴能够帮助刚入行小白们解决一些技术问题。今天,我们将一起探讨如何实现“Docker CMD 执行文件执行”。这个问题可能听起来有些复杂,但通过一步一步指导,我相信你很快就能理解并掌握它。 ## 流程概览 首先,让我们通过一个表格来了解整个流程步骤: | 步骤 | 描述 | | --- | ---
原创 2024-07-26 06:59:17
21阅读
一、sql语句执行步骤: 1)语法分析,分析语句语法是否符合规范,衡量语句中各表达式意义。 2) 语义分析,检查语句中涉及所有数据库对象是否存在,且用户有相应权限。 3)视图转换,将涉及视图查询语句转换为相应对基表查询语句。 4)表达式转换, 将复杂 SQL 表达式转换为较简单等效连接表达式。 5)选择优化器,不同优化器一般产生不同执行计划” 6)选择连接方式, ORACL
转自 linux下执行.sh文件方法 .sh文件就是文本文件,如果要执行,需要使用chmod a+x xxx.sh来给可执行权限。是bash脚本么 可以用touch test.sh #创建test.sh文件 vi test.sh #编辑test.sh文件 加入内容#!/bin/bash mkdir test保存退出。 chmod a+x test.sh #给test.sh可执行权限 如test,
转载 2024-07-04 18:36:17
27阅读
接下来将介绍Linux中一些常用文件操作命令,今天先演示五个类型命令操作,内容不是特别的全,找几个典型常用演示,想要全面的可以另找资料了解一下,推荐大家跟着敲跟着做才能加深记忆,祝大家学开心,另外提醒大家,每个命令关键词后面必须加空格然后再写后面的操作。目录一、新建操作二、查看操作1、查看目录(代码中数字是我自己加,为了方便对应阅读)2、查看文件内容(代码中数字是我自己加,为了
## 实现"bat文件执行java中方法执行"步骤 ### 1. 创建Java项目 首先,我们需要创建一个Java项目,用来编写我们需要执行方法。 ### 2. 创建一个要执行Java方法 在我们Java项目中,创建一个类并在其中编写我们需要执行方法。 ```java public class MyClass { public static void main(Str
原创 2023-12-08 16:41:31
54阅读
1.一般在开始声明    setlocal enabledelayedexpansion 设置本地为延迟扩展。其实也就是:延迟变量,全称延迟环境变量扩展,使得批处理能够感知到变量动态变化,在运行过程中给变量赋值。2. @echo off   表示在此语句后所有运行命令都不显示命令行本身(默认是on), 如果不想显示本身可以用@echo
文章目录一、cmd下运行java文件1.命令格式2.例子3.找不到或无法加载主类二、输出cmd下参数1.命令格式2.例子1:以格式1方式3.例子2:以格式2方式三、例题 一、cmd下运行java文件1.命令格式javac xxx.java 编译java格式文件成class格式文件,compile编译 java xxx 运行xxxclass文件,不能写.class后缀,否则错2.
转载 2023-05-23 22:21:43
96阅读
文章目录Python(三)——如何运行Python程序1、终端运行2、源文件运行3、Pycharm2022.1下载4、Pycharm简单配置5、Python注释 Python(三)——如何运行Python程序1、终端运行在命令行窗口中直接输入代码,按下回车键就可以运行代码,并立即看到输出结果;执行完一行代码,你还可以继续输入下一行代码,再次回车并查看结果……整个过程就好像我们在和计算机对话,所以
  1:环境变量配置 A:桌面“我电脑”--- 属性 --- 高级 --- 环境变量单击此按钮进入环境变量设置,如果有Path变量把“C:/WINDOWS/Microsoft.NET/Framework/v2.0.50727”路添加到Path变量值中;如果没有Path变量则“新建”---变量名设为“Path”,变量值设为“C:/WINDOWS/Micros
转载 2024-06-04 07:25:11
17阅读
上一篇实现了 JAVA 调用 C 语言函数过程,当然 C 也能通过 JNI 来访问 JAVA 方法和成员变量,实际上具体调用什么函数以及如何实现这些具体操作,都在 jni 手册中有进行讲解。下面以程序来实现 C 调用 JAVA 方法或成员变量过程。先是一个简单访问 JAVA 静态成员方法程序 JAVA代码:public class Hello { /* C来访问这个静态成员
转载 2023-09-27 19:14:08
36阅读
文件介绍什么是文件 狭义说:文本文件;广义说:超文本文件, 图片,声音,超链接,视频文件分类 文件大体上可以分为两类,文件文件和二进制文件文件作用 数据持久化文件操作流程 打开文件读写关闭文件读写文件操作读取文件操作f = open('123.txt',mode='r') content = f.read() f.close()写文件操作f = open('123.t
编写代码com.hhh.test.PackageTestpackage com.hhh.test; public class PackageTest { public static void main(String[] args) { System.out.println("Hello World"); } }com.hhh.test2.PackageTest2p
转载 2023-09-26 21:05:59
75阅读
当一个PE文件执行时,PE装载器首先检查DOS MZ header里PE header偏移量。如果找到,则直接跳转到PE header位置。 当PE装载器跳转到PE header后,第二步要做就是检查PE header是否有效。如果该PE header有效,就跳转到PE header尾部
PE
原创 2021-07-20 13:51:21
359阅读
# Ruby 文件执行入口 Ruby 是一种高层次、解释型编程语言,以其简洁和灵活性而受到开发者喜爱。当我们运行一个 Ruby 文件时,常常会问:“我代码是从哪里开始执行?” 本文将带您深入探讨 Ruby 文件执行入口,帮助您理解 Ruby 执行模型及其工作机制。 ## Ruby 文件执行入口 在 Ruby 中,文件执行入口是由一个特定代码块定义。当您通过命令行运行一个
原创 11月前
50阅读
# Python 文件执行顺序 Python是一种简单而强大编程语言,它执行顺序对于理解和掌握Python编程至关重要。在本文中,我们将探讨Python文件执行顺序,并通过代码示例加以说明。 ## Python文件执行顺序 在Python中,文件执行顺序是从上到下,即按照文件中代码顺序逐行执行。这意味着在代码中函数、类或变量必须在使用之前定义。在具体介绍Python文件
原创 2024-01-04 06:57:01
129阅读
在许多情况下,我们需要将 Java 文件打包为可执行文件,以便于分发和使用。尽管 Java 本身运行是通过 Java 虚拟机(JVM)来实现,但通过一些工具和步骤,我们能轻松地将 Java 应用打包成独立执行文件。接下来,我会详细介绍如何实现这个过程,包括环境准备、集成步骤、配置详解、实战应用、性能优化以及生态扩展。 ## 环境准备 首先,为了确保整个流程顺畅进行,我们需要准备必要
原创 7月前
43阅读
计算机执行一个可执行文件流程可执行文件C源代码为: main.c#include <stdio.h> int main(int argc, char *argv[]) { puts("Hello World"); return 0; }编译完成后,生成一个可执行文件Demo。执行流程如下:双击可执行文件Demo,告诉操作系统我们要执行执行文件。操作系统接受到用户请求后
Python中初始化文件(`__init__.py`)是一个特殊Python文件,它用于定义一个包或模块初始化代码。在Python中,当一个包被导入时,其内部`__init__.py`文件会被自动执行,这使得我们可以在这个文件执行一些初始化操作,比如定义包级别的变量、导入子模块等。 ### 初始化文件作用 初始化文件主要作用有以下几点: 1. **定义包级别的变量和函数:** 在
原创 2024-03-01 05:11:40
68阅读
  • 1
  • 2
  • 3
  • 4
  • 5